Understanding Diaphragm Seal Type Pressure Gauge Factories


Diaphragm seal type pressure gauges are essential instruments used to measure the pressure of a wide range of fluids in various industrial applications. These gauges prevent the process fluid from coming into direct contact with the measuring element, ensuring accurate readings and extending the lifespan of the instrument. The Importance of Diaphragm Seal Pressure Gauges


In many industrial settings, the fluids being measured can be corrosive, viscous, or filled with particulates. Traditional pressure gauges, which rely on direct contact between the fluid and the measuring element, can suffer from inaccuracies and premature failure under such conditions. This is where diaphragm seal pressure gauges shine. The diaphragm acts as a barrier, allowing pressure to transmit to the instrument without allowing the process fluid to cause damage.


The construction of these gauges typically involves a flexible diaphragm that deforms under pressure. This deformation is transmitted to the gauge mechanism, which then produces a readable measurement. The separation of the process fluid from the gauge components minimizes wear and tear, thus ensuring longevity and reliability.


The Manufacturing Process


The manufacturing of diaphragm seal type pressure gauges involves several pivotal steps. First, high-quality materials are selected based on the chemical compatibility and temperature requirements of the intended application. Common materials include stainless steel, monel, and different elastomers for the diaphragm, depending on the fluid properties.


Once the materials are sourced, skilled technicians begin the fabrication process. This includes the precise machining of components, assembly of the diaphragm and housing, and integration with the pressure sensing element. During assembly, it is crucial to ensure that all seals are perfect to prevent leaks, which could compromise the integrity of the readings.

Quality control is paramount throughout the manufacturing process. Factories often utilize advanced testing techniques, including calibrating the instruments against known standards and subjecting them to various pressure and temperature conditions to confirm their accuracy and reliability.


Benefits of Diaphragm Seal Type Pressure Gauges


One of the primary benefits of these gauges is their ability to withstand harsh operating conditions. The diaphragm seal minimizes the risk of clogging and corrosion, which can occur with direct-contact gauges, making them ideal for challenging environments.


Another advantage is the versatility these gauges offer. They can be configured for use in a variety of applications, from food processing and pharmaceuticals, where hygienic conditions are essential, to oil and gas industries, where high levels of pressure and corrosive substances are prevalent.


Furthermore, their maintenance requirements are significantly reduced. With fewer mechanical parts exposed to the process fluid, the risk of damage is lower, which translates to less downtime and reduced maintenance costs for businesses.
